These golden, pan-seared veggie tots are an excellent low-carb, flour-free alternative to traditional potato sides. Packed with grated zucchini, carrots, and bell peppers, they are perfect for anyone looking for a quick, healthy snack or a light dinner option.
Ingredients
• 2 medium zucchinis, finely grated
• 1 medium carrot, finely grated
• 1/2 green bell pepper, finely diced
• 2 large eggs
• 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ella or parmesan cheese (optional, for binding and flavor)
• Salt and black pepper to taste
• 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
• 1 tablespoon olive oil (for pan-searing)
Instructions
1. Squeeze Out Excess Moisture
• Place the grated zucchini and carrot in a clean kitchen towel or cheesecloth.
• Squeeze forcefully over the sink to remove as much water as possible. This step is crucial to ensure your tots hold their shape and get crispy without using flour.
2. Mix the Ingredients
• In a large bowl, combine the squeezed zucchini and carrots with the finely diced green bell pepper.

3. Shape the Tots
• Take a small handful of the mixture and press it firmly between your palms, shaping it into an oblong, cylinder-like tot. Repeat until all the batter is used.
4. Cook Until Golden
• Heat the olive o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ium heat.
• Carefully place the tots into the skillet. Cook for 3 to 4 minutes per side, gently flipping them with a spatula until they develop a beautiful brown, crispy crust on all sides.
5. Serve
